Giuseppe di Stefano - Catari, Catari!




Here's a nifty tape that when the computer crashed I lost my entire, well-written, witty review.

We have selections by Neopolitan tenor Giuseppe di Stefano, backed by the New Symphony Orchestra of London, performing your basicly brilliant Neopolitan singing. The album is a London FFST tape, but, as you can see by the back of the box, it's a Japanese release! No slouches, this King Record Co., as they released it on Sony tape! This was in the pile of Japanese tapes I was going through a couple of weeks ago, but I didn't notice it for some reason until I looked at the back of the box. Silly me.

This is some brilliant singing, making me pine for a cappucino and biscotti somewhere in a sidewalk cafe in Naples, to be followed by liberal dashes of a decent wine, while watching the world pass by.

I have never seen this one show up in the thrift stores on London or UK Decca on LP, so I am thinking that this may be a new treat for many of you, it certainly was for me!

THe orchestra, the New Symphony Orchestra of London (under the capable baton of Iller Pattacini) backs Signore di Stefano very well, bringing a great flair to the proceedings.

I think that you will enjoy this tape, much as I did when listening to it during the encode pass, which was a GREAT way to start a beutiful early autumn day in the Rockies.
